How they compare

Mexico currently reports 0.5449 kt against 0.2091 kt in Iran (Islamic Republic of), a difference of 0.3358 kt.

That makes Mexico's figure about 2.6 times Iran (Islamic Republic of)'s.

Across all 65 years both countries report, Mexico has been ahead every year.

Iran (Islamic Republic of) ranks 8th and Mexico ranks 10th of 20 countries.

Mexico has averaged higher in every one of the 9 decades both report.

The FAOSTAT domain on Emissions Totals summarizes the greenhouse gas (GHG) emissions disseminated in the FAOSTAT Climate Change domains of emissions from agrifood systems. Data are computed following the Tier 1 methods of the Intergovernmental Panel on Climate Change (IPCC) Guidelines for National greenhouse gas (GHG) Inventories (IPCC, 1996; 1997; 2000; 2002; 2006; 2014). Emissions from other economic sectors as defined by the IPCC are also disseminated in the domain for completeness.
